a couple gunsmithing projects

british style 375 H&H built on a oberndorf mauser action. I threaded and chambered the barrel myself. opened up the bolt face and action to fit the 375. bolt handle and bottom metal is from duane wiebe and the stock blank was from great American. sights are necg and I rust blued it myself.

pile of parts


bottom metal and bolt handle


I need a bigger lathe


inletted into the stock, still need to finish shape the stock


rust blued, silvers pad on the stock and a couple coats of red oil on the stock.
I've put about 120 rounds through it so far.

here are a couple more spare parts builds.
I just happened to have a remington mosin nagant with a shot out barrel, a .222 barrel from a Remington 722, a .220 swift ackley reamer and a lathe.
rethreaded and rechambered the barrel.


modified the bolt head, ejector and extractor. I basically copied the bolt, extractor and ejector mods that were done on my bannerman 30-06 mosin conversion


slapped it in a p.o.s. plastic stock and put some sights from one of my junk boxes on it.


shoots good and feeds from the magazine.

then there's the redneck sniper monstrosity, aka "Cletus"
started out as a shot out hex receiver mosin, finned barrel is from a madsen light machine gun, rethreaded and chambered in 7mmx54r, had it in 7mm-08 for a while but decided it needed to be chambered in a 7.62x54r based wildcat, so I cut it back then rethreaded and rechambered. stock is a home made contraption, scope mount is a burris p.e.p.r. ar-15 mount turned backwards.
